19// We rank extensions in the following order:
20// -Single letter extensions in canonical order.
21// -Unknown single letter extensions in alphabetical order.
22// -Multi-letter extensions starting with 'z' sorted by canonical order of
23// the second letter then sorted alphabetically.
24// -Multi-letter extensions starting with 's' in alphabetical order.
25// -(TODO) Multi-letter extensions starting with 'zxm' in alphabetical order.
26// -X extensions in alphabetical order.
27// -Unknown multi-letter extensions in alphabetical order.
28// These flags are used to indicate the category. The first 6 bits store the
29// single letter extension rank for single letter and multi-letter extensions
30// starting with 'z'.

38// Get the rank for single-letter extension, lower value meaning higher
39// priority.
40static unsigned singleLetterExtensionRank(char Ext) {
41 assert(isLower(Ext));
42 switch (Ext) {
43 case 'i':
44 return 0;
45 case 'e':
46 return 1;
47 }
48
49 size_t Pos = RISCVISAUtils::AllStdExts.find(Ext);
50 if (Pos != StringRef::npos)
51 return Pos + 2; // Skip 'e' and 'i' from above.
52
53 // If we got an unknown extension letter, then give it an alphabetical
54 // order, but after all known standard extensions.
55 return 2 + RISCVISAUtils::AllStdExts.size() + (Ext - 'a');
56}
57
58// Get the rank for multi-letter extension, lower value meaning higher
59// priority/order in canonical order.
60static unsigned getExtensionRank(const std::string &ExtName) {
61 assert(ExtName.size() >= 1);
62 switch (ExtName[0]) {
63 case 's':
64 return RF_S_EXTENSION;
65 case 'z':
66 assert(ExtName.size() >= 2);
67 // `z` extension must be sorted by canonical order of second letter.
68 // e.g. zmx has higher rank than zax.
69 return RF_Z_EXTENSION | singleLetterExtensionRank(ExtName[1]);
70 case 'x':
71 return RF_X_EXTENSION;
72 default:
73 if (ExtName.size() == 1)
74 return singleLetterExtensionRank(ExtName[0]);
76 }
77}
78
79// Compare function for extension.
80// Only compare the extension name, ignore version comparison.
81bool llvm::RISCVISAUtils::compareExtension(const std::string &LHS,
82 const std::string &RHS) {
83 unsigned LHSRank = getExtensionRank(LHS);
84 unsigned RHSRank = getExtensionRank(RHS);
85
86 // If the ranks differ, pick the lower rank.
87 if (LHSRank != RHSRank)
88 return LHSRank < RHSRank;
89
90 // If the rank is same, it must be sorted by lexicographic order.
91 return LHS < RHS;
92}
